Novel cooperative caching strategies for video streaming distribution based on reconfiguration routers
A novel cooperative caching scheme based on reconfiguration routers was proposed to accelerate the delivery of streaming media.Through cooperative caching for popular videos among the routers,the server capability,especially bandwidth requirements were decreased.Moreover,the traffic over the backbon...
